#54156b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54156b is composed of 32.9% red, 8.2%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.5% cyan, 80.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 284 degrees, a saturation of 67.2% and a lightness of 25.1%. #54156b color hex could be obtained by blending #a82ad6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#54156b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54156b has RGB values of R:84, G:21, B:107 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 5510507.

Shades and Tints of #54156b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070209 is the darkest color, while #fcf7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#54156b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#423c44 is the less saturated color, while #5d017f is the most saturated one.
